I've finally got around to photographing a few rooms in my home. By showing these to you I am also exposing my neuroses surrounding my inability to design my own space. For clients, I make decisions quickly and determinedly - but in my own home I can't hang art on the walls. For my clients I have a clear design vision from the start but my own home is a mix-mash of styles and items I love but simply don't go very "designerly" together. I fear a completed and cohesive space because I know I'll redesign the room the minute it was finished. I am afraid I disappoint people when they visit "a designer's house". I have heard that I am not the only interior designer with this issue, but seeing other beautiful homes of designers I think I actually may be.
My house is always "in progress" but here are a few shots of what it looks like at this moment of time.
